Summary

On 23 June 1995 at about 19:05 local time, a Cessna 180H registered N2790X was involved in an accident near Monroe, Washington, United States. One person was on board and one had minor injuries. The aircraft was substantially damaged. The NTSB has published a probable cause for this accident; it is quoted in full below.

Probable cause

THE PILOT'S FAILURE TO MAINTAIN AIRSPEED.

DURING LANDING, THE AIRCRAFT BOUNCED AND THE PILOT EXECUTED A GO-AROUND. HE APPLIED FULL THROTTLE AND RETRACTED THE FLAPS FROM FULL TO ONE NOTCH. HE REPORTED THAT THE AIRCRAFT SEEMED TO HANG IN A STALL AND DIDN'T ACCELERATE. THE AIRCRAFT VEERED LEFT OFF THE RUNWAY, THEN SETTLED INTO TALL GRASS AND NOSED OVER.
